Abstract

This exploratory qualitative study examines how teacher leadership mobilizes school communities to transform character education within Indonesia’s Freedom Curriculum (Kurikulum Merdeka). Conducted across five elementary schools in urban and rural settings of East Lombok, the study involved 10 Guru Penggerak teachers, alongside school leaders and parents as supporting informants. Data were collected over a six-month period (December 2024–April 2025) through semi-structured interviews, classroom and schoolwide observations, and document analysis, and were analyzed using inductive thematic analysis. The findings identify three observable domains of transformation: (1) the integration of character values into daily instructional practices through project-based and reflective learning activities, (2) the strengthening of school culture via teacher-led routines, visual character symbols, and collective norms, and (3) the expansion of character education beyond school through structured home–school collaboration. Across the participating schools, teachers reported consistent improvements in student participation, discipline, respect for peers, and responsibility, corroborated by observational data and parent feedback. The study demonstrates that character education reform becomes more coherent and sustainable when teacher leadership functions as a mobilizing force that aligns classroom practice, school culture, and community involvement. These findings contribute empirical evidence to policy discussions on scaling teacher-led character education within national curriculum reform.

Abstract

Writing is one of the language skills that is considered difficult because students are required to express ideas in written English correctly. This study aims to investigate the effect of using picture series in improving students’ writing skills. This study used experimental research in a junior high school. The results of this study indicate that the use of series of images has made a significant difference in improving students' writing skills. A series of images that are chosen appropriately can build students' interest and attention to the learning process. This will create an enthusiastic and lively learning atmosphere. Things that need to be considered are the selection of series of images that are easy and familiar to students to avoid irrelevant comments from students, series of images should not be funny images that will cause irrelevant comments and an uncontrolled classroom atmosphere. Giving students assignments individually can waste time in teaching writing using series of images. To avoid this, it is recommended to distribute copies of the picture series to students a week in advance, so that students can study the pictures early.

Abstract

AbstractThis study aims to uncover (1) the challenges to foster literacy culture in the digital era, (2) the value of literacy conveyed through fairy tales, (3) the role of fairy tales for literacy and numeracy, and (4) the outcomes observed in literacy and numeracy development through fairy tales. The research used the qualitative approach with the case study method. Interviews, observations, and documentation were employed as data collection techniques. The collected data were analyzed through data collection, data reduction, data presentation, and drawing conclusions. The research results show that (1) the challenges of literacy culture in the digital era starts with finding and evaluating; (2) the literacy value conveyed through fairy tales includes literacy values encompassing listening, speaking, reading, and writing, while the value of numeracy includes skills in symbols and number, information analysis, and problem solving; (3) the role of fairy tales is as a medium to capture student’s attention. Fairy tales provide entertainment and moral teachings, which are engaging young learners since most children today prefer to see images rather than text. Abstract

AbstractThis research was conducted to uncover the extent to which prospective elementary school teachers can utilize problem-based learning methods to improve their critical thinking skills. We employed a single-group pre-test experimental research approach, incorporating a pre-test and a post-test. 47 prospective elementary school teachers in Sarjanawiyata Tamansiswa University comprise this research sample. The analysis of data used the tests Wilcoxon and N Gain Score. These results show the problem-based learning methods that effectively enhanced the critical thinking of prospective elementary school teachers. The Wilcoxon test results reveal a statistically significant effect of problem-based learning methodologies on the development of critical thinking skills in students, with a sig value of 0.000. The test results for the means of the N Gain Score center on improving critical thinking competence in which their mean score is 0.61 and their average percentage is 61.07. Abstract

Practical E-Guidebook is a facility for practicum activities that contains digital-based instructions and information so that students can carry out practicum activities independently. The aim of this research is to analyze the need for practical science e-guidebooks for UIN Sunan Kalijaga students. This research uses the ADDIE (Analysis, Design, Development, Implementation, Evaluation) development research model in the analysis stage. The data collection techniques used in this research were interviews and questionnaires to determine the analysis of students' needs for the Practical E-Guidebook. The aspects analyzed in this research are analysis of independent practicum activities for elementary science learning, analysis of tools and materials in the laboratory in independent practicum activities for elementary science learning, analysis of media availability in independent practicum activities for elementary science learning, analysis of the benefits of the Practical E-Guidebook for science in practicum activities independent Elementary School Science Learning, analysis of the need for innovation in science practicum learning media. This research found that there was an average percentage of 82% with the majority of students stating that the Practical Science E-Guidebook needed to be developed so that the implementation of independent practical activities for students in elementary science learning courses could run in a structured manner and the preparation of reports could be well structured.

Abstract

Abstract: Technological advancements have facilitated access to electronic books (e-books), which are becoming increasingly popular as language learning media due to their interactive multimedia features. This bibliometric study aims to map the development of research on e-books in language learning using data from Scopus analyzed with the Bibliometrix package. The analysis reveals that the literature is centered around themes of reading literacy and the integration of educational technology, highlighting e-books as a key component in supporting reading comprehension and enhancing motivation in language learning. The study also finds that research is predominantly contributed by developed countries (notably China, the United States, and Japan), supported by strong institutional funding, while international collaboration remains limited. The contribution of this study is to provide a comprehensive map of research trends, collaboration networks, and dominant themes in the field of e-books for language learning, while also identifying research gaps that warrant further investigation. The comprehensive bibliometric analysis maps publication trends, author collaboration, and key topics related to e-books in language learning. The findings indicate that students’ reading literacy and the use of educational technology are dominant themes, with e-books playing a vital role in improving reading comprehension and learning engagement. Cross-country research collaboration remains limited, highlighting the need to strengthen global scientific networks to bridge research capacity gaps in this field.. Employing a mixed-methods approach with a sequential explanatory design, the research involved 148 students and 10 teachers in Butuh District, Purworejo Regency, utilizing questionnaires, interviews, and observations for data collection. The results indicate a significant gap in digital media integration, with 84.2% of students reporting that teachers had never used such media and 80% of teachers lacking consistency in its application. Key findings reveal that 82.9% of students struggle with sandhangan and pasangan characters, yet there is a high interest in technology (94.5%) and educational games (89%). Although 90% of teachers agree that educational games enhance motivation, infrastructure remains a primary obstacle. It is concluded that there is an urgent need for interactive learning media tailored to children's cognitive development. The "Monopoly Hybrid" media is proposed as an effective solution, combining physical play with technology to foster a fun and motivating learning environment. These results serve as a foundation for developing instructional media in the next research phase.
